




What if personal power was not something you had to chase, but something you could return to by becoming more fully yourself? And what might change in your life and relationships if you learned to lead from that place of truth? This immersion invites you to explore the body as a steady inner compass, one that can guide you toward clarity, alignment, and self-trust.
Rooted in the wisdom of somatics, this experience reflects a simple but profound idea: the body carries important keys to authenticity, presence, and meaningful change. By noticing internal signals, recognizing familiar patterns, and coming back to center, participants create space for choice and honest expression. Rather than focusing on what is “wrong,” this work supports the deeper process of becoming.
Guided through trauma-informed facilitation, the workshop includes solo reflection, partnered exploration, small-group practice, and collective experience. Drawing from somatics, embodied and Authentic Relating, breathwork, vocal activation, and expressive movement, the sessions move beyond theory into lived practice, allowing insight to be felt, explored, and integrated in real time.

Live Extended Education Program
Join a cohort of 16 learners in a rigorous course of study, up to 26 hours per week over either two weeks or four weeks, depending on the program. As part of the program, participants are required to dedicate 26 hours of service each week in one of Esalen’s operational departments.
Program Schedule
The day after arrival at Esalen, the program begins with an orientation meeting, where participants receive the class schedule and service assignment. Additional activities can be found on the open class schedule, and general schedule information includes arrival, departure, and meal times.
Accommodations
LEEP student housing is dorm-style and gender-inclusive, with four students sharing a room.
Tuition & Fees
Tuition is $1600 for two-week programs and $2900 for four-week programs, and includes accommodations, meals, and the workshop. A non-refundable $20 application fee is collected when applying and will be applied to the deposit if accepted. Upon acceptance, a non-refundable deposit of $800 holds a space for two-week programs, and $1450 holds a space for four-week programs.
